I love this stuff. I don't care how it flies just as long as it's going around. Here's my Ray Malmstrom saucer. My son is holding it on the far right at our 1/2A day https://www.facebook.com/PhillyFliersCL/        It's the opening pic at the top of the page

         My buddy Dennis built this prototype Saucer for Pat King. Enya .35 for power, we flew that thing all day long. It was a fun plane to fly http://pdkllc.com/super-saucer-115/

          I would love to see someone build this plane. These things were just plain out fun projects.
